Device Status Problem (fixed)

Hello everyone,

We received some device connection errors from our monitoring systems early today. The problem started at 01:30 AM EST / 6:30 AM BST, causing devices to become offline, thus unmanageable from the platform.

The root cause was identified as some of the backend servers got overloaded due to the latest release (https://forum.xcitium.com/forum/gene…2022#post10641)

The systems went back to normal at 05:50 AM EST / 10:50 AM BST, and endpoints started to become online and are working as expected.

We are closely monitoring all systems to make sure everything is stable.

The device connection status problem reapperared again.

The main problem is not with the actual device connection, but its’ representation on the platform. Even if the devices are available, also can be remotely accessed, it is being shown as offline on the platform.

Currently teams are trying to fix the problem as soon as possible, but we have no ETA as of now.
